New Microsoft AdCenter Changes – So Long 20 Million Keyword Campaigns

Posted June 30th, 2006 by Jeremy Schoemaker

Today I loged into my adcenter account to upload some new keywords and I kept getting errors. Everything from sql error to that annoying error 1 that we all know and love.

Then I got a new error. It said that my keywords had exceeded the max allowed. I am guessing this to be somewhere around 40-50k.

I think my days of 20 million keyword campaigns on adcenter for nickel clicks are over =( was a good run lol….

I expect Microsoft will come out with a official announcement in the next week… or they wont.
